When you play in SWTOR you have to interact with other characters in your story line. This is one of the things that really attracted me to the game. It was more than just killing stuff, there was this whole story. It was almost like Role Playing. When you come to a character you have to converse with there is a symbol over his/her head. You click on the character and the scene starts. Say you're asked a question. You will be given three options to pick for your answer. The trick here is what you read is not necessarily the words that will come out of your character's mouth.
At one point, I don't remember when, but it was early on, I had picked something and I gave the best smart ass remark. It was better than anything I could have ever come up with. After that it was my mission to pick the option that would give me the most sarcastic response. That didn't happen every time. There were options I picked that I swore would give me a good response and it didn't. Also sometimes I didn't get picked. My friend's response was picked instead. This happens when you're playing in a group. The game might choose your partner instead of your character.
